Indeed, the science you're referring to is often associated with fields like Nuclear Engineering or Radiation Physics. It involves:
- **Radiation Producing Devices**: These are devices that generate radiation, including charged particles, neutrons, and photons. They are used in a variety of applications, from medical imaging to industrial inspection.
- **Nuclear Electronics Equipment**: This refers to the electronic devices used in nuclear experiments and applications, such as detectors, amplifiers, and data acquisition systems.
- **Identification of Industrial Parameters by Radiating Sources**: This involves using radiation sources to measure or identify certain parameters in industrial processes. For example, radiation can be used to measure thickness, density, or composition of materials in quality control processes.
This field requires a deep understanding of physics, engineering, and mathematics, and plays a crucial role in many sectors, including healthcare, energy, and manufacturing. It's a fascinating area of study for those interested in the practical applications of nuclear science.
